Getting a fuel sender lock ring off usually ends with a brass drift, a hammer and a chewed-up collar, and that is before anyone thinks about doing it over an open tank. This three-jaw wrench grips the collar properly and turns it, so the ring comes out intact and goes back the same way.
Adjusts from 100 mm to 170 mm
The three jaws slide out to suit collars anywhere between 100 mm and 170 mm (3.9-6.7 in), which is the band most in-tank pump and fuel gauge sender rings fall into. Rather than owning a separate cup spanner for every vehicle, the jaws are set to the ring in front of you and locked there. Measure your collar across its lugs before ordering. If the ring falls outside that range, no amount of adjustment will bring it in.
Driven by a 19 mm spanner
With the jaws locked onto the collar, the tool is turned using a 19 mm spanner or socket. That detail matters: it lets a long bar or a breaker go on a seized ring so you can apply steady torque rather than shock loads. The supplier describes it as a non-invasive method of removing and reinstalling the collar, which is the point of using a proper wrench in the first place. No 19 mm spanner is listed as included, so have one ready.

Before you use it
- Opening a fuel tank access ring releases petrol vapour. This work belongs to someone competent, in a well-ventilated space, well away from ignition sources.
- No vehicle fitment list is published. Measure your own collar against the 100-170 mm range before ordering.
